## Account Recovery — Gridwhistle Crossword Generator

Plugin authors locked out of the Gridwhistle publishing dashboard should first attempt a standard reset. If the reset token never arrives, use the offline recovery flow. Open the recovery console, select your plugin namespace, and confirm ownership. When prompted, supply the recovery passphrase shown below.

strongbox words: fraath-isteth

## Further reading

The Kestrelcode transcoding farm scales worker pools based on queue depth in Renderhive, with priority lanes for live-event jobs. Recent changes to the chunking strategy reduced p95 latency but increased storage churn, which we'll cover at the sync. Background on the scheduler design, capacity model, and open questions is collected on the internal page below.

runbook for badug-kadup: https://confluence.zemvarlabs.internal/projects/browse/display/projects/bd1b

MEMO — Department Heads

Re: FY budget request for the Larkspur tooling upgrade

After reviewing vendor quotes and maintenance logs from the Delverton plant, we are requesting an additional 340,000 in capital funds. The figure covers equipment replacement, staff retraining, and a modest contingency. Operating savings should offset the outlay within nineteen months. Before the committee votes, please review the note below.

management briefing: Ralokix Partners plans to lower the Istath list price by 38 percent in October.

Hi,

We completed the cut-over of the Moneta conversion service last night. The old path rounded at each intermediate hop, which accumulated drift of up to three basis points on chained conversions; the new path carries full precision internally and rounds once at presentation. From a review standpoint: the precision change does not alter auth boundaries, and audit logs now record both raw and rounded amounts. Reconciliation against yesterday's ledger showed zero discrepancies. The service now runs with these configuration values.

config for yajep-tafof:
[rusath]
team = julmir
access_code = ac_fe37fd
host = rusath.novactech.test
port = 8000
owner = pelmir.weneth
peer = oliwyn.olvarqdyn.internal